Barbara Jean Herring

August 14, 1934 — October 29, 2017

Barbara Jean Warren was born on August 14, 1934 in Nashville, TN to Milton and Margie Warren. She received a formal education through the Nashville public school system graduating from Haynes High School in 1952. Barbara turned her life over to Christ at an early age, and was faithful throughout her life.

Barbara was united in holy matrimony to George Edward Herring Sr. and to that union was blessed with four children. She was an active member of Friendship Missionary Baptist Church serving on the Mother’s board and Senior choir. A member of the Stone River District Missionary Board Association and the Haynes High School Alumni Association until her health failed.

Barbara began her work career with George W. Hubbard Hospital as a dietary worker. She was employed by the college for 31 years, working herself up through the ranks retiring as a registered dietitian and manager of the cafeteria. She enjoyed cooking, singing, gardening and making her favorite hand cranked homemade vanilla Ice Cream and spending time with her grandchildren.

Barbara participated with the Northwest YMCA Silver Sneakers Senior fitness program and was a recipient of the volunteer of the year award. She was also editorialized in the May 1998 of the Goodwill Ambassador as a peer Counselor with the Senior Community Service Employment Program (SCSEP) for her managerial skills, positive attitude and genuine concern for others.

Leaving to cherish her memories, four children, Vickie (William) Cummins, Amanya Diggs Jackson, George (Chevene) Herring and David Herring; four grandchildren, Anthony Carlos (Tawanna) Petway, Verneda Herring, Anethia Diggs and Quinton Herring; three great grandchildren, Taniya & Anthony Petway II and William Dailey IV; two sisters, Eleanor (Willie) Smith, Julia Britt and a host of nieces, nephew, cousins, relatives and friends.
